Transaction 4676e104f3c66a6ce967681c4a7e95cd4a0b29fbe44da742433d432f96d1cd01

2 Input
2 Outputs
  • 4676e104f3c66a6ce967681c4a7e95cd4a0b29fbe44da742433d432f96d1cd01:0
  • value  1037949
    address  17KS3aPD4SsTsYsMuPA35gTFmW29mHAyS7
  • 4676e104f3c66a6ce967681c4a7e95cd4a0b29fbe44da742433d432f96d1cd01:1
  • value  123660
    address  1Lgykjgj1XWgdBDqcdU9DshC8tEvEQ24RS